Correlation and regression. The word correlation is used in everyday life to denote some form of association. We might say that we have noticed a correlation between foggy days and attacks of wheeziness. However, in statistical terms we use correlation to denote association between two quantitative variables.

WebJul 9, 2024 · You can get any correlation (except exactly 1 or -1) and not have linearity; a large (magnitude of) correlation doesn't necessarily imply the relationship is actually linear (nor does a small one imply that it isn't); correlation is not of itself a useful way to decide on the suitability of a linear regression model.
